CodeProject.AI Server can currently

Detect objects in images
Detect faces in images
Detect the type of scene represented in an image
Recognise faces that have been registered with the service
Pull out the most important sentences in text to generate a text summary
Remove the background automatically from images
Blur the background of images to produce a portrait effect
Generate a sentiment score for text
